What Tennessee Employers Look For

The qualifications that appear most often in business operations manager jobs across Tennessee.

  • Bachelor's degree in business administration, operations management, or a related field
  • Three or more years of experience managing cross-functional teams or business processes
  • Demonstrated proficiency with ERP systems such as SAP, Oracle, or Microsoft Dynamics
  • Experience developing and monitoring KPIs, budgets, and operational performance metrics
  • Strong project management skills, often supported by PMP or Six Sigma certification
  • Familiarity with Tennessee's healthcare, manufacturing, or logistics regulatory environment

Business Operations Manager Jobs in Tennessee: Frequently Asked Questions

How do you become a business operations manager in Tennessee?

Most business operations manager roles in Tennessee require a bachelor's degree in business administration, operations management, or a closely related field, with employers in healthcare-heavy markets like Nashville often preferring candidates who understand clinical or revenue cycle operations. Tennessee does not require a state-issued license for this role, but certifications like the Project Management Professional or a Lean Six Sigma credential from an accredited body strengthen candidacy considerably. Several Tennessee universities offer relevant graduate programs that local employers recognize.

How much do business operations managers make in Tennessee?

Business operations managers in Tennessee earn a median of about $106,970 a year, based on May 2025 Bureau of Labor Statistics wage data, ranging from around $50,820 for the lowest 10% to over $230,660 for the top 10%. Pay rises with experience, specialty, and employer.

Which Tennessee cities have the most business operations manager jobs?

Nashville, Memphis, and Knox County have the most business operations manager openings in Tennessee. Nashville leads because of its dense cluster of healthcare corporations and corporate headquarters, while Memphis draws significant volume from logistics, distribution, and supply chain employers tied to its role as a major freight hub, and Knoxville sees steady demand from manufacturing and university-affiliated organizations in the eastern part of the state.

Are there remote business operations manager jobs in Tennessee?

Yes, and more than many comparable roles, since business operations management is largely analytical and coordination-based rather than tied to a physical production floor. About 50% of business operations manager openings tied to Tennessee are remote or hybrid as of August 2026, reflecting how broadly the role has shifted toward digital workflows. Strategy, vendor management, and reporting functions tend to be the most remote-friendly parts of the job.

How can I get hired as a business operations manager in Tennessee with little or no experience?

The most realistic entry path is moving into an operations coordinator or business analyst role at a large Tennessee employer and building toward management from within. Healthcare systems like HCA Healthcare and Vanderbilt University Medical Center run structured associate programs and often promote from administrative or analyst positions. Earning a Lean Six Sigma Yellow or Green Belt certificate signals process-improvement competency and gives candidates without a management title a concrete credential that Tennessee hiring managers recognize as an indicator of readiness.
